What is a Psychiatric Evaluation?
A psychiatric evaluation is a structured procedure where a mental health expert evaluates an individual’s mental health through interviews, questionnaires, and standard tests. The primary function of this evaluation is to identify mental health conditions and to establish a treatment strategy customized to the individual’s needs.

Elements of a Psychiatric Evaluation
A psychiatric evaluation typically consists of numerous parts, each created to gather important details about the specific and their mental health.
-
Medical Interview: The foundation of the evaluation, where the clinician engages with the patient to explore their symptoms, medical history, and any pertinent life occasions.
-
Mental Status Examination (MSE): An assessment of the patient’s present frame of mind that consists of observations about their look, state of mind, cognition, and believed processes.
-
Mental Testing: Standardized tests might be utilized to provide objective measures of mental health and cognitive performance.
-
Observations: Clinicians might observe the individual in different circumstances to examine behavior and emotional reactions.
-
Security Information: Gathering details from household members, caregivers, or previous healthcare companies can you see a psychiatrist privately include valuable context.
-
Diagnostic Criteria: The assessment might consist of using the DSM-5 (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ders) or ICD-10/ ICD-11 (International Classification of Diseases) criteria for classification.

Common Settings for Psychiatric Evaluations
Psychiatric examinations can occur in various contexts, each with its own focus and specialized technique:
-
NHS Mental Health Services: Typically offer assessments for people experiencing serious mental health problems or emergency situations.
-
Private Practices: Often offer more regular or specialized evaluations, emphasizing patient convenience and tailored treatment plans.
-
Community Mental Health Centres: Focus on serving individuals within particular communities, typically incorporating other assistance services.
-
Inpatient Units: When people are hospitalized, assessments may happen within the very first couple of days and will concentrate on stabilization and instant treatment needs.
